Laparoscopic cytoreductive surgery and hyperthermic intraperitoneal chemotherapy for gastric cancer with intraoperative detection of limited peritoneal metastasis: a Phase II study of CLASS-05 trial.
Tian LinXinhua ChenZhijun XuYanfeng HuHao LiuJiang YuGuoxin LiPublished in: Gastroenterology report (2024)
L-CRS followed by HIPEC can be safely performed for gastric cancer with limited peritoneal metastasis and potential survival benefits.
